Werner LEMBERG <address@hidden> wrote:
 |> but what i really would like to do is rather
 |>
 |>   .if !d \V[GROFF_NO_MDOCMX]
 |>
 |> so to be synchronous with $GROFF_NO_SGR.  Well i am, but only on
 |> grotty(1) level, not in the macros, which is odd.
 |> Wouldn't it be, even more, natural to be able to use "d" for that?
 |
 |\V always returns a string.  If the environment variable is not
 |defined, it returns an empty string.

 |It might be possible to create another interface to environment
 |variables, but I strongly doubt that it is worth the trouble.

And it's not that alone, it is also that "-dSTRING" doesn't work
as expected, it has to be "-dSTRING=VALUE", even though ".ds
STRING" will do.  I have to look into that.
